HUNSUCKER v. GLOBAL BUSINESS FURNITURE

No. 33972-CA.

768 So.2d 698 (2000)

Sarah E. HUNSUCKER, et vir., Plaintiffs-Appellants, v. GLOBAL BUSINESS FURNITURE, et al., Defendants-Appellees.

Court of Appeal of Louisiana, Second Circuit.

September 27, 2000.


Attorney(s) appearing for the Case

Jack Patrick Harris, Baton Rouge, Counsel for Plaintiffs-Appellants.

E. Joseph Bleich, Counsel for Defendants-Appellees.

Before BROWN, GASKINS and DREW, JJ.


H. DREW, J.

In this products liability suit, plaintiffs appeal a judgment sustaining Globe Business Furniture of Tennessee, Inc.'s exception of prescription.

We affirm.
